MPD: Two in custody after two people killed and five others injured in shooting outside Prive

MPD said the shooting happened after an altercation inside the club late Wednesday night.

MEMPHIS, Tenn. — Memphis Police said two people are in custody after two people were killed and five others were injured in a shooting at Prive restaurant Wednesday night.

MPD officers responded to the shooting in the 6900 block of Winchester about 11:15 p.m. on March 29, 2023. MPD said officers arrived to find two men shot in the parking lot. One died at the scene, the other was taken to Regional One Hospital, but he later died due to his injuries. 

Investigators said five other people were also shot and injured, and all went to the hospital in personal vehicles. MPD said they are a 35-year-old male, a 30-year-old male, a 25-year-old female, a 37-year-old male, and a 31-year-old male. As of Friday afternoon, MPD said four of the injured are still in critical condition, and one was released. 

Investigators said a fight started inside the club, and some of the individuals involved went to their cars and got guns, then began shooting. MPD said they are reviewing video footage from the scene.

Investigators said one of the suspects in custody faces a charge of first-degree murder, and the second faces charges of attempted first-degree murder and aggravated robbery. They are not currently releasing any more information on the suspects.

Police said they believe the two men who died were targeted in the shooting. They said the others who were injured may have been bystanders at the scene.
